Abstract

Expressions for the ideal free-space backprojected image of an object with known transition matrix (T-matrix) are derived for scalar and vector electromagnetic waves in bistatic and monostatic geometries. Discrete backprojection sums are extended to continuous integrals over source/receiver spheres. Images are formed without the need to generate or process scattered field data. The final expressions only depend on regular wave functions in the frame of the object and the object T-matrix. The formulation is validated numerically using the aggregate T-matrix solution for a collection of acoustic and dielectric spheres. Applications include assessment and validation of free-space focusing and T-matrix scattering solutions.
